関数またはプログラム モジュールの前に説明的なコメント ブロックを配置できます。 C /* MATHERR.C illustrates writing an error routine * for math functions. */ コメントには入れ子になったコメントを含めることができないため、この例ではエラーが発生します。
関数定義は、関数の名前、受け取ることを想定するパラメーターの種類と数、および戻り値の型を指定します。 関数定義には、ローカル変数の宣言を持つ関数本体と、関数の処理を決定するステートメントも含まれます。 構文 translation-unit:
この場合、scha_resource_get() 関数がハンドルを通じて獲得した情報は正しくない可能性があります。 リソースでクラスタの再構成や管理アクションが行われた場合、RGM は scha_err_seqid エラーコードを scha_resourcegroup_get() 関数に戻し、リソースが変更されたことを示します。 このメッ...
このインターフェイスは、リソースのオープンとクローズ、トランザクションの管理、型付きバッファの管理、要求/応答型サービス呼び出しや会話型サービス呼び出しの起動などを行う関数呼び出しを提供します。コミュニケーション・パラダイム...
この記事では、C 言語でexecvp関数を利用する方法について複数の方法を紹介します。 C 言語でプロセスイメージを置き換えるためにexecvp関数を使用する Unix ベースのシステムでは、新しいプロセスを作成するためのシステムコールと、実行中のプロセスに新しいプログラムコードをロードするた...
ダウンロードコードを実行する 出力: a = 10, b = 20, c = A 3.アレイ ポインタとストラットを使用して、関数からさまざまなデータ型の値を返す方法を見てきました。これで、すべての値が同じデータ型である場合、以下に示すように、値をアレイにカプセル化してそのアレイを返すこ...
特にmalloc関数については、メモリの確保も含めて下記ページで詳しく解説していますので、詳細を知りたい方は下記ページを別途ご参照していただければと思います。 【C言語】malloc関数(メモリの動的確保)について分かりやすく解説 メモリの解放 ...
NULL ポインタをキャストすることは、関数が動作するために必須であり、可変数の引数の終わりを示すことにも注意してください。要するに、2 番目の位置の引数はプログラムのコマンドライン引数を指定しなければならず、そのうちの最初の引数はファイル名そのものでなければならません。
デフォルトのコンストラクター、デストラクター、コピー・コンストラクター、 およびコピー代入演算子は、特殊なメンバー関数です。 これらの関数は、クラス・オブジェクトを作成、破棄、変換、初期化、およびコピーします。これらの関数については以下のセクションで説明します。
//メイン関数を使用しないプログラム #include <iostream> usingnamespacestd; classDemo { public: Demo()//コンストラクタ { cout<<"Inside Constructor "<<endl; exit(EXIT_SUCCESS); } }; staticDemos; intmain() { cout<<"Inside main() - never executed"; ...